Prevention Basics 200: Promoting Evidence-based Prevention
Tuesday, June 7 - Wednesday, June 8, 2011 - 09:30 AM - 04:30 PM
This two-day classroom-based training will introduce strategies to promote evidence-based prevention with a variety of audiences. Providers will learn strategies for achieving success and overcoming barriers. This course is only open to Comprehensive Grant Program (CGP) Providers funded through the IL DHS Substance Abuse Prevention Program. Participants must successfully complete Prevention Basics University - Level 1 (PB101, PB102 and PB103) prior to participation in PB200.This training must be completed during the Provider's second year of employment. Please note that program staff should allow at least 6 months between completion of the PBU Level 1 training program and participation in the PBU 200-Level training program.
